Я хочу реализовать кеш изображений, но не хочу использовать стороннюю библиотеку, например cached_network_image
.
Как мне создать свой собственный флаттер кешированного сетевого изображения?
Пожалуйста, возьмите изображение сети ниже и используйте его в качестве примера?
Ссылка на изображение: https://user-images.githubusercontent.com/54469196/100622834-b026a180-3364-11eb-9c35-0582686397d7.png
Чтобы реализовать кешированное изображение без использования cached_network_image , вы должны использовать плагин, который используется cached_network_image для работы, то есть flutter_cache_manager . Вы можете увидеть, как плагин используется в cached_network_image, увидев код из его GitHub-репозитория и соответствующим образом внедрив его в свое приложение.
Надеюсь, что это поможет вам! Если вы все еще сталкиваетесь с какой-либо проблемой, сообщите об этом в комментариях.
Да, я проверил это. Но смотреть надо много. Я был бы признателен, если бы вы могли указать часть, которую мне, возможно, нужно посмотреть